Compare all specifications:
2006 BMW M6 | 1955 Lancia Aurelia | |
Make | BMW | Lancia |
Model | M6 | Aurelia |
Year Released | 2006 | 1955 |
Body Type | Coupe | Convertible |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5000 cc | 2451 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 10 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Horse Power | 507 HP | 116 HP |
Torque | 705 Nm | 186 Nm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 12.0:1 | 9.0:1 |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Vehicle Length | 4830 mm | 4210 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1840 mm | 1560 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1370 mm | 1510 mm |
